About Elements, Inspired by Ciel Bleu at The Okura Prestige Bangkok (One Michelin Star)

Experience fine dining at its finest at Elements, inspired by Ciel Bleu, a Michelin-starred restaurant at The Okura Prestige Bangkok. This intimate culinary destination seamlessly blends French expertise with Japanese influences, offering innovative cuisine in a relaxed yet sophisticated setting with panoramic views of Bangkok's glittering skyline.

Local Legends & Stories

Elements carries the legacy of Ciel Bleu, Amsterdam's celebrated Michelin-starred restaurant, bringing world-class fine dining expertise to Bangkok. The Okura Prestige Bangkok stands as a landmark hotel representing Japanese hospitality standards, making this restaurant a cultural bridge between Dutch culinary excellence and Japanese service philosophy.

Elements, inspired by Ciel Bleu


AN AUTHENTIC FINE DINING EXPERIENCE IN BANGKOK


The Michelin-starred restaurant Elements, inspired by Ciel Bleu serves French cuisine with Japanese influences in a relaxed, informal setting with menus that reflect a remarkable blend of textures, temperatures, flavours and colours. Enjoy stunning views of downtown Bangkok from the alfresco cantilevered deck before dining in comfort and style in our culinary theatre complete with open kitchen.

Frequently Asked Questions

The experience includes a multi-course tasting menu featuring French cuisine with Japanese influences, prepared in the open kitchen. Beverages, gratuity, and additional items are not included unless a specific beverage pairing package is selected.
A full tasting menu experience at Elements typically takes between two and three hours to complete. This allows time to enjoy the alfresco deck before moving to the main dining room.
The restaurant maintains a smart casual dress code, requiring collared shirts and closed-toe shoes for men, while prohibiting shorts, flip-flops, and sleeveless shirts. The atmosphere is designed to be a relaxed, informal culinary theatre with an open kitchen.
Elements is located on the 25th floor of The Okura Prestige Bangkok on Wireless Road. The nearest public transit is the BTS Skytrain, with Ploen Chit station located just a short walk from the hotel entrance.
The restaurant is primarily suited for adults and older children due to the formal fine-dining environment and extended tasting menu duration. Children under 12 are generally discouraged, and high chairs or specialized children's menus are not standard offerings.
The Okura Prestige Bangkok provides elevator access to the 25th floor, and the restaurant entrance and main dining areas are wheelchair accessible. Guests requiring specific seating arrangements near the open kitchen or alfresco deck should notify the restaurant in advance.
Arriving around sunset allows guests to view the downtown Bangkok skyline transitioning from day to night from the cantilevered deck. The outdoor area is primarily used for pre-dinner drinks before guests are seated in the main dining room.
Guests must present a valid booking confirmation, either digitally on a mobile device or as a printed copy, along with a matching photo ID upon arrival. The restaurant operates on a strict reservation system and requires the name on the booking to match the guest.
Reservations must be cancelled or modified at least 48 hours prior to the scheduled dining time to avoid a full cancellation fee. Failure to show up or arriving significantly late without prior notice will result in the forfeiture of any prepaid deposits.
The kitchen can accommodate most dietary restrictions and allergies if notified at least 48 hours before the reservation. However, due to the complex nature of the French-Japanese tasting menu, completely vegan or highly restrictive allergy modifications may not be possible.
